Upper Village, Bath NH Neighborhood GuideHistoric character and settingUpper Village is the historic heart of Bath, NH, defined by classic New England architecture and a picturesque riverside setting. Centered near the Ammonoosuc River, the village showcases 19th-century homes, white-steepled churches, and brick landmarks. Visitors are drawn to the Bath Covered Bridge and The Brick Store, often cited as one of America?s oldest continuously operating general stores. With tree-lined lanes and mountain views, Upper Village offers postcard-ready scenes in every season. Its compact, walkable core makes it easy to explore local history, photography spots, and small-town hospitality. Lifestyle, recreation, and accessibilityOutdoor enthusiasts appreciate quick access to covered bridge byways, Ammonoosuc River fishing, and scenic drives toward the White Mountains. Leaf peeping, snowshoeing, and nearby trail networks around Franconia Notch and the Connecticut River corridor broaden four-season appeal. The neighborhood?s calm pace pairs with convenient connections along US Route 302 and NH Route 10 for day trips to Littleton, Woodsville, and beyond.
